harmony-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Alexey Varlamov (JIRA)" <j...@apache.org>
Subject [jira] Closed: (HARMONY-4093) [drlvm][jit] regtest H2113 hangs on Win64
Date Tue, 24 Jul 2007 07:14:31 GMT

     [ https://issues.apache.org/jira/browse/HARMONY-4093?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
]

Alexey Varlamov closed HARMONY-4093.
------------------------------------

    Resolution: Cannot Reproduce

Verified, closing.

> [drlvm][jit] regtest H2113 hangs on Win64
> -----------------------------------------
>
>                 Key: HARMONY-4093
>                 URL: https://issues.apache.org/jira/browse/HARMONY-4093
>             Project: Harmony
>          Issue Type: Bug
>          Components: DRLVM
>         Environment: Windows 2003 SP1, x86_64, MSVC2005
>            Reporter: Alexey Varlamov
>            Priority: Minor
>
> The regression test for HARMONY-2113 hangs on Win64 in debug/release modes, due to endless
loop in HashTableImpl::lookupEntry
> The stack is:
> >	jitrino.dll!Jitrino::HashTableImpl::lookupEntry(void * key=0x0000000004091c00) 
Line 119 + 0x6 bytes	C++
>  	jitrino.dll!Jitrino::InstFactory::makeClone(Jitrino::VarAccessInst * inst=0x000000003283df00,
Jitrino::OpndManager & opndManager={...}, Jitrino::OpndRenameTable & table={...})
 Line 889 + 0x10 bytes	C++
>  	jitrino.dll!Jitrino::CloneVisitor::accept(Jitrino::VarAccessInst * inst=0x0000000003bc52cb)
 Line 644 + 0x14 bytes	C++
>  	jitrino.dll!Jitrino::InstFactory::clone(Jitrino::Inst * inst=0x0000000000000000, Jitrino::OpndManager
& opndManager={...}, Jitrino::OpndRenameTable * table=0x000000003283df30)  Line 675 +
0xe bytes	C++
>  	jitrino.dll!Jitrino::duplicateNode(Jitrino::IRManager & irm={...}, Jitrino::Node
* node=0x0000000004097c58, Jitrino::StlBoolVector<Jitrino::StlMMAllocator<bool> >
* nodesInRegion=0x000000000023e2f0, Jitrino::DefUseBuilder * defUses=0x000000000023e410, Jitrino::OpndRenameTable
* opndRenameTable=0x0000000004091c00)  Line 295 + 0x18 bytes	C++
>  	jitrino.dll!Jitrino::_duplicateRegion(Jitrino::IRManager & irm={...}, Jitrino::Node
* node=0x0000000004097c58, Jitrino::Node * entry=0x0000000004097c58, Jitrino::StlBoolVector<Jitrino::StlMMAllocator<bool>
> & nodesInRegion={...}, Jitrino::DefUseBuilder * defUses=0x000000000023e410, Jitrino::NodeRenameTable
* nodeRenameTable=0x0000000004091c78, Jitrino::OpndRenameTable * opndRenameTable=0x0000000004091c00)
 Line 315	C++
>  	jitrino.dll!Jitrino::inlineJSR(Jitrino::IRManager * irManager=0x0000000004091c78, Jitrino::Node
* block=0x00000000040938e0, Jitrino::DefUseBuilder & defUses={...}, Jitrino::StlMultiMap<Jitrino::Inst
*,Jitrino::Inst *,std::less<Jitrino::Inst *>,Jitrino::StlMMAllocator<std::pair<Jitrino::Inst
* const,Jitrino::Inst *> > > & entryMap={...})  Line 592 + 0x2a bytes	C++
>  	jitrino.dll!Jitrino::inlineJSRs(Jitrino::IRManager * irManager=0x0000000003c69570)
 Line 690	C++
>  	jitrino.dll!Jitrino::FlowGraph::doTranslatorCleanupPhase(Jitrino::IRManager & irm={...})
 Line 850	C++
>  	jitrino.dll!Jitrino::TranslatorSession::postTranslatorCleanup()  Line 81	C++
>  	jitrino.dll!Jitrino::runPipeline(Jitrino::CompilationContext * c=0x000000000023e740)
 Line 230	C++
>  	jitrino.dll!Jitrino::Jitrino::CompileMethod(Jitrino::CompilationContext * cc=0x0000000004028690)
 Line 269 + 0x21 bytes	C++
>  	jitrino.dll!JIT_compile_method_with_params(void * jit=0x0000000002d8c188, void * compilation=0x000000000023ec98,
Method * method_handle=0x0000000000000000, OpenMethodExecutionParams compilation_params={...})
 Line 284 + 0xd bytes	C++
>  	harmonyvm.dll!compile_do_compilation_jit(Method * method=0x0000000000000000, JIT *
jit=0x0000000005124380)  Line 658 + 0x1a bytes	C++
>  	em.dll!DrlEMImpl::compileMethod(Method * mh=0x000000000520e010)  Line 545 + 0xe bytes
C++
>  	harmonyvm.dll!compile_me(Method * method=0x0183004400640016)  Line 795	C++
> Probably there is some issue with changed STL impl for MSVC2005.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


Mime
View raw message